Comparative Analysis of Clinical Outcome and Complications in Primary Versus Revision Adult Scoliosis Surgery

Adult patients undergoing primary scoliosis surgery had significantly lower overall complications compared with revision patients. Primary patients reported higher preoperative and final clinical outcome measures than revision patients, although this difference disappeared in older patients. The benefit of surgery was similar between the 2 groups.
